## Artifact Signing — Parceline Webhook

For this week's sync: all parcel-tracking webhook payload bundles shipped to carrier partners must now be signed before publication. The signer runs in the webhook-release stage and rejects unsigned builds. Verification happens on the partner side, so a mismatched key means silent delivery failures — treat rotation carefully and announce it a week ahead. Current signing material for the webhook artifacts is below.

rollout seal: bky4_x7Gc

### Step 4 — Point FeedCheck at the new store

The Larkspur validator no longer reads feeds.db locally. All validation results now live in the shared Ostrel cluster. Stop the old worker, flush pending jobs, and update the validator config before restart. Do not reuse the legacy credentials; they were rotated during cutover. Set the connection value to the following.

replica DSN, yahog-kawig: redis://istox_svc:um@db-8a67.halixforge.test:5432/frawyn

## Getting started with Fabrikit

Welcome aboard! Fabrikit is our test-data factory library — it builds realistic orders, users, and invoices for the Pondwrack staging environment so you never have to hand-craft fixtures at 3 a.m. Most factories are self-explanatory; check the traits folder for edge cases like refunded orders. One gotcha: seeding staging requires decrypting the anonymized snapshot before Fabrikit can layer fixtures on top. That snapshot is locked with a team-wide recovery passphrase, which you'll find just below this line.

strongbox words: zorath-holmir